xscsiha  - probe and control scsi buses accessed using the
       SGI linux-xscsi subsystem.


SYNOPSIS

       xscsiha [-lprtTws] [-D debuglevel] [-L targetID|all]
               [-S targetID|all] {{bus} ...


DESCRIPTION

       xscsiha is used  to  perform  operations  on  fibrechannel
       loops of SCSI devices and parallel SCSI buses.

       The  following  options  apply  to  both parallel SCSI and
       fibrechannel SCSI:

       -p     Probe for devices on the bus or loop.  On  parallel
              SCSI  buses,  this option causes the driver to look
              for devices at  every  ID  on  the  SCSI  bus.   On
              fibrechannel  SCSI  loops,  this  option causes the
              driver to look for devices at  every  ID  that  was
              reported in use at the most recent loop initializa­
              tion.  On parallel SCSI buses,  when  a  device  is
              found  at  lun  0,  all other luns are then probed.
              When devices or luns are not valid, a warning  mes­
              sage   may   be   printed  on  the  console.   With
              fibrechannel, the Report Luns SCSI command is  used
              to  determine  which LUNs are valid.  If the Report
              Luns command returns error, only LUN 0  is  assumed
              to be valid.

       -r     Perform a SCSI bus reset and/or reset host adapter.

              This affects all devices on that SCSI bus,  causing
              current  commands  to be aborted, and specially set
              parameters to be reset, in many cases.  Tape  drive
              state will be reset after this, and any tape opera­
              tions in progress will be aborted.

              This option should therefore be used with some cau­
              tion.  In very rare cases, it may cause a device to
              become unusable without a  powercycle.   There  are
              times  when  it  is  desired  to  reset  devices or
              adapters that appear to be hung, however,  so  this
              function  is  provided.   Some host adapter drivers
              will reset the  adapter  as  part  of  this  ioctl.
              Fibrechannel adapters will perform loop initializa­
              tion, making  this  operation  similar  to  the  -l
              option, except that the adapter will also be reset.

       -D debuglevel
              Set the debug level in  the  host  adapter  driver.
              Where  supported, this option changes the verbosity
              of a given host adapter driver.  In general,  0  is
              least verbose, with no specific upward limit.

       The  following  options  only  apply  to Fibrechannel SCSI
       adapters:

       -l     Perform loop initialization.  During loop  initial­
              ization,  all  devices  on the loop will attempt to
              acquire a target ID.  SGI devices will  attempt  to
              get  the  ID they have been selected for, either by
              settings on and position within an enclosure, or by
              dials/switches  on the device.  If multiple devices
              have the same ID selection, only  one  device  will
              get that ID.  Other devices will attempt to acquire
              IDs not in already in use.

              This option may have a side effect of aborting cur­
              rent  commands  outstanding  on  the adapter, so it
              should be used with care.   The  disk  driver  will
              typically  reissue  the aborted commands, but there
              will be a performance  impact  while  commands  are
              reissued.

       -L targetID
              Send  LIPRST  to the specified device and then per­
              form loop initialization.  This option is much like
              -l  above,  except  that  it also requests that the
              device resets itself.  Not all devices  will  honor
              the  request.   RAID  controllers  typically  don't
              while disk drives typically do.  This option can be
              used  in rare cases where a device is not function­
              ing properly, but is still able  to  complete  loop
              initialization  and acquire a target ID.  For exam­
              ple, if a drive gets timeouts on attempts to  probe
              (using  the  -p option above), then this option may
              bring  it  back  to  working  condition.   In  this
              respect, the -L option can be used for reasons sim­
              ilar to -r on parallel SCSI buses.

       -L all This option is like the -L option  directly  above,
              except  that  it directs all devices to reset them­
              selves.  Only devices  that  implement  FC-AL-2  or
              later  will  respond  to  this.  This option can be
              used  if  a  loop  is  malfunctioning,  and  it  is

              The -L options may have a side effect  of  aborting
              current commands outstanding on the adapter, and it
              if the device honors the reset function,  outstand­
              ing  commands  to  it  will  be  dropped.  The disk
              driver will typically reissue the aborted commands,
              but  there  will be a performance impact while com­
              mands are reissued and while a device resets.

       -T     Display a  listing  of  targets  connected  to  the
              fibrechannel adapter.

       -w     This  option  will  print  the  portname (sometimes
              known as the World Wide Name) of  the  fibrechannel
              adapter.

       -s     This option will print the link error statistics of
              the fibrechannel adapter.  The link  error  statis­
              tics  will  be  displayed  with  an  asterix before
              adapter loop id  (in  case  of  loop  topology)  or
              before  the  adapter  portname  (in  case of fabric
              topology).

       -S targetID
              This option will print the link error statistics of
              the  specified  fibrechannel target.  The target ID
              can be either unit number (in case of  loop  topol­
              ogy) or nodename (in case of fabric topology).

       -S all This option will print the link error statistics of
              the fibrechannel adapter and all the  targets  con­
              nected to it.

       This command is normally usable  only  by  the  superuser,
       because   the  standard  permissions  of  the  devices  in
       /dev/xscsi/* restrict access to other users.

       With Fibrechannel adapters, if a loop is  broken  after  a
       system  has  been  operational,  numerous attempts will be
       made to  reinitialize  the  loop,  after  which  the  host
       adapter  driver  will give up on the loop.  At this point,
       if the hardware condition causing the broken loop is fixed
       (box  of  drives powered back on, cable reinserted, etc.),
       the -r option should be used to re-establish  loop  opera­
       tion.
